description Product Description

Used in pharmaceutical synthesis as an intermediate for antihypertensive drugs, particularly in the development of angiotensin II receptor antagonists. It serves as a building block in the preparation of thiazole-based bioactive molecules, contributing to improved metabolic stability and receptor binding affinity. Commonly employed in research settings for structure-activity relationship studies targeting cardiovascular therapies. Also utilized in the production of agrochemicals and functional materials due to its heterocyclic backbone.
